Sasha is 43 years old and has multiple developmental disabilities. His life has been difficult from the very beginning: when his mother learned of his diagnoses, she gave him up. Sasha first ended up in a baby home, then in an orphanage, and later — in a psychoneurological institution for adults. In this closed facility, he became withdrawn, stopped talking, and could spend hours just standing by the window. It was clear that life in the institution was unbearable for him. With help from a lawyer at “Perspektivy,” permission was obtained for his discharge, and Sasha moved into supported housing. For the past two years, this cozy apartment has been home to five young people with severe disabilities whom “Perspektivy” helped begin a new, more independent life. Every day, the residents receive support and assistance from the organization’s staff. During this time, Sasha has changed a lot: he’s become more sociable, found an accessible job, and started acting in theater. He set up his own room and even got an aquarium with fish. Now he has things he never had in the institution — communication, celebrations, personal space and belongings, and the ability to make his own decisions. His interest in life has returned, along with the desire to take care of himself. A social worker supports the residents of the apartment in all areas of their lives.
